Power Cut

Normality has been restored today after a power cut yesterday caused havoc with our operations at the bakery. The telephone lines were down all day (what did we do before mobiles?) and production was hampered, causing a knock-on effect on despatch.

Disruption to our customers was minimised thankfully and everything is running smoothly again now!
